How they compare
Thailand currently reports 2.53 million against 2.35 million in Saudi Arabia, a difference of 186,930.
That makes Thailand's figure about 1.1 times Saudi Arabia's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Thailand ahead.
Saudi Arabia ranks 23rd and Thailand ranks 21st of 217 countries.
Thailand has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Saudi Arabia | Thailand |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 113,349 | 1.16 million | 1.05 million | Thailand |
| 1970s | 184,620 | 1.51 million | 1.33 million | Thailand |
| 1980s | 387,050 | 2.27 million | 1.88 million | Thailand |
| 1990s | 590,544 | 2.82 million | 2.23 million | Thailand |
| 2000s | 1.18 million | 2.68 million | 1.50 million | Thailand |
| 2010s | 2.30 million | 2.59 million | 295,828 | Thailand |
| 2020s | 2.27 million | 2.59 million | 319,460 | Thailand |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
